    Abstract: The present disclosure is directed to apparatuses and methods for diagnosing a swallowing dysfunction. The apparatus may include a multi-parametric dysphagia analysis system in a plastic foil. The analysis systems may be smart sensing systems that are flexible, lightweight, and based on substrates having low-cost printed electronics technologies thereon. The methods may include measurement and classification of non-invasive parameters that may be indicative of a swallowing dysfunction or the probability of same. In a general embodiment, the methods include placing a sensor on a patient for measurement of at least one parameter associated with the patient's swallowing profile. The measured parameter is then analyzed and compared with several known normal and dysphagic swallowing profiles to provide an indication of the probability of an underlying swallowing dysfunction.
